
Harare fading giants Dynamos who are on a rebuilding course with the intention of bringing glory days back and be able to compete with the leagues best, have begun their hunt for five experienced players.
A reliable sources close to what is happening in the Glamour Boys camp told 263Chat that DeMbare was in hunt for two defenders, a combative midfielder and two strikers.
“As you know that DeMbare is on a rebuilding exercise, the club is looking for two defenders, a midfielder and two strikers.
“It is however unfortunate that while the team is looking to bolster their squad with new names, they will also be forced to offload big names as well. There are a number of players who are not performing to the coaches required standards.”
The source could not throw around the names of the players the club is targeting.
Speaking after today’s training in the capital, Dynamos coach Tonderai “Stanza” Ndiraya said he was looking forward to building a a strong team that will be able to compete at the top level.
“I cannot deny or confirm reports that we are hunting for experienced player. All I can tell you is that we are looking forward to rebuilding a strong team that will bring back glory days at DeMbare,” said Ndiraya.
Meanwhile Dynamos will take on new boys Manica Diamonds at Rufaro Stadium this Sunday.
